They scale fine, but there is a point beyond which adding additional peers to the overlay routing merely adds latency. Don't have time to look up the references now, but there are a number of papers discussing the advantages of different numbers of peers (superpeers in a lot of systems) needed for overlay routing. You don't need 10M.
